Sachse High School Principal Ray Merrill was recognized by The Texas Association of Secondary School Principals as Principal of the Year.

Sachse High School Principal Ray Merrill was recognized by The Texas Association of Secondary School Principals as Principal of the Year.

The Texas Association of Secondary School Principals recently recognized outstanding administrators from the state’s 20 regional education service centers. Sachse High School Principal Ray Merrill was nominated and named Principal of the Year for exemplary performance and outstanding leadership.

In just four years, Merrill has helped implement innovative and technologically advanced initiatives.

“We now offer more innovative technology courses, some with dual credit, have increased the rigor in all of our technology courses, and much of our professional development is preparing our staff for the one to one student devices that are coming with our bond,” he said. “We have some great teacher leadership in our technology department.”
